		<title>High fibre, yogurt consumption could help lower lung cancer risk</title>

			<content:encoded><![CDATA[<p id="first" class="lead"><span style="color: #808080;"><em>Health News —</em></span> A diet high in fibre and yogurt is associated with a reduced risk for lung cancer, according to a new analysis.</p>
<div id="text">
<p>The benefits of a diet high in fibre and yogurt have already been established for cardiovascular disease and gastrointestinal cancer. These new findings published in <a href="https://jamanetwork.com/journals/jamaoncology/article-abstract/2753175" target="_blank" rel="noopener"><em>JAMA Oncology</em></a> and based on an analysis of data from studies involving 1.4 million adults in the United States, Europe and Asia, suggest this diet may also protect against lung cancer.</p>
<p>Participants were divided into five groups, according to the amount of fibre and yogurt they consumed. Those with the highest yogurt and fibre consumption had a 33% reduced lung cancer risk as compared to the group who did not consume yogurt and consumed the least amount of fibre.</p>
<p>&#8220;Our study provides strong evidence supporting the US 2015-2020 Dietary Guideline recommending a high fibre and yogurt diet,&#8221; said senior author Xiao-Ou Shu, MD, PhD, MPH, Ingram Professor of Cancer Research, associate director for Global Health and co-leader of the Cancer Epidemiology Research Program at Vanderbilt-Ingram Cancer Center.</p>
<p>The association, she said, was &#8220;robust&#8221;, consistently across current, past and never smokers, as well as men, women and individuals with different ethnic backgrounds.</p>
<p>Shu suggests the health benefits may be rooted in the prebiotic (nondigestible food that promotes growth of beneficial microorganisms in the intestines) and probiotic properties of both these foods. The properties may independently or synergistically modulate gut microbiota in a beneficial way.</p>

		<title>Vegetable-rich diet lowers fatigue, raises good cholesterol in MS sufferers</title>

			<content:encoded><![CDATA[<p id="first" class="lead"><em><span style="color: #808080;">Natural Health News</span> —</em> Higher levels of blood high-density lipoprotein (HDL) &#8211; or good cholesterol &#8211; may improve fatigue in multiple sclerosis patients, according to a new study.</p>
<div id="text">
<p>The pilot study, which investigated the effects of fat levels in blood on fatigue caused by multiple sclerosis, found that lowering total cholesterol also reduced exhaustion.</p>
<p>The results, published recently in <a href="https://journals.plos.org/plosone/article?id=10.1371/journal.pone.0218075" target="_blank" rel="noopener"><em>PLOS ONE</em></a> highlight the impact that changes in diet could have on severe fatigue, which impacts the majority of those with multiple sclerosis.</p>
<p><strong>Fighting fatigue</strong></p>
<p>Fatigue is a frequent and debilitating symptom for people with multiple sclerosis that affects quality of life and ability to work full time. Despite its prevalence and the severity of its impact, treatment options for fatigue are limited. The medications used to treat severe fatigue often come with unwanted side effects.</p>
<p>&#8220;Fatigue in people with multiple sclerosis has been viewed as a complex and difficult clinical problem with contributions from disability, depression and inflammation. Our study implicates lipids and fat metabolism in fatigue,&#8221; said lead researcher Murali Ramanathan, PhD, professor in the University of Buffalo School of Pharmacy and Pharmaceutical Sciences. &#8220;This is a novel finding that may open doors to new approaches for treating fatigue.&#8221;</p>
<p>In previous studies, Terry Wahls, MD, clinical professor of internal medicine and neurology and creator of the Wahls Protocol diet, and her team of researchers at the University of Iowa, showed that a diet-based intervention accompanied by exercise, stress reduction and neuromuscular electrical stimulation (NMES) is effective at lowering fatigue. However, the physiological changes underlying the improvements were unknown.</p>
<p><strong>Leafy greens and fruits</strong></p>
<p>The researchers examined changes in body mass index (BMI), calories, total cholesterol, HDL, triglycerides, and low-density lipoprotein (LDL) &#8211; commonly known as bad cholesterol. Fatigue was measured on the Fatigue Severity Scale.</p>
<p>The small study followed 18 progressive multiple sclerosis patients over the course of a year who were placed on the Wahls diet, which is high in fruits and vegetables. The diet encourages the consumption of meat and fish as well as plant-based protein, plenty of leafy green vegetables, brightly coloured fruits like berries and fat from animal and plant sources, especially omega-3 fatty acids. Gluten, dairy and eggs are excluded.</p>
<p>Participants also engaged in a home-based exercise program that included stretches and strength training, NMES to stimulate muscle contraction and movement, and meditation and self-massages for stress reduction. However, adherence to the diet was the main factor associated with reductions in fatigue.</p>
<p>&#8220;Higher levels of HDL had the greatest impact on fatigue,&#8221; said Ramanathan, &#8220;possibly because good cholesterol plays a critical role in muscle, stimulating glucose uptake and increasing respiration in cells to improve physical performance and muscle strength.&#8221;</p>

		<title>Organic apples contain more &#8216;good&#8217; bacteria</title>

			<content:encoded><![CDATA[<p>Natural Health News — To the heroes among you who eat the whole apple: besides extra fiber, flavonoids and flavor, you&#8217;re also quaffing 10 times as many bacteria per fruit as your core-discarding counterparts.</p>
<p>Is this a good thing? Probably. But it might depend on how your apples were grown.</p>
<p>Published in <em><a href="https://www.frontiersin.org/articles/10.3389/fmicb.2019.01629/full" target="_blank" rel="noopener">Frontiers in Microbiology</a></em>, a new study shows that organic apples harbor a more diverse and balanced bacterial community &#8211; which could make them healthier and tastier than conventional apples, as well as better for the environment.</p>
<p><strong>You are what you eat</strong></p>
<p>Nowhere more so than your bowel.</p>
<p>&#8220;The bacteria, fungi and viruses in our food transiently colonize our gut,&#8221; says study senior author Professor Gabriele Berg, of Graz University of Technology, Austria. &#8220;Cooking kills most of these, so raw fruit and veg are particularly important sources of gut microbes.&#8221;</p>
<p>To help us choose our colonic colonists wisely, Berg&#8217;s group analyzed the microbiome of one of the world&#8217;s favorite fruits: the apple.</p>
<p>&#8220;83 million apples were grown in 2018, and production continues to rise,&#8221; says Berg. &#8220;But while recent studies have mapped their fungal content, less is known about the bacteria in apples.&#8221;</p>
<p>The researchers compared the bacteria in conventional store-bought apples with those in visually matched fresh organic ones. Stem, peel, flesh, seeds and calyx &#8211; the straggly bit at the bottom where the flower used to be &#8211; were analyzed separately.</p>
<p><strong>The organic apple advantage</strong></p>
<p>Overall, the organic and conventional apples were occupied by similar numbers of bacteria.</p>
<p>&#8220;Putting together the averages for each apple component, we estimate a typical 240g apple contains roughly 100 million bacteria,&#8221; reports Berg.</p>
<p>The majority of the bacteria are in the seeds, with the flesh accounting for most of the remainder. So, if you discard the core &#8211; for shame! &#8211; your intake falls to nearer 10 million. The question is: are these bacteria good for you?</p>
<p>When it comes to gut health, variety is the spice of life &#8211; and in this regard, organic apples seem to have the edge.</p>
<p>&#8220;Freshly harvested, organically managed apples harbor a significantly more diverse, more even and distinct bacterial community, compared to conventional ones,&#8221; explains Berg. &#8220;This variety and balance would be expected to limit overgrowth of any one species, and previous studies have reported a negative correlation between human pathogen abundance and microbiome diversity of fresh produce.&#8221;</p>
<p>Specific groups of bacteria known for health-affecting potential also weighed in favor of organic apples.</p>
<p>&#8220;<em>Escherichia-Shigella</em> &#8211; a group of bacteria that includes known pathogens &#8211; was found in most of the conventional apple samples, but none from organic apples. For beneficial Lactobacilli &#8211; of probiotic fame &#8211; the reverse was true.&#8221;</p>
<p>And there may even be vindication for those who can &#8220;taste the difference&#8221; in organic produce.</p>
<p>&#8220;Methylobacterium, known to enhance the biosynthesis of strawberry flavor compounds, was significantly more abundant in organic apples; here especially on peel and flesh samples, which in general had a more diverse microbiota than seeds, stem or calyx.&#8221;</p>
<p><strong>Consumer choice</strong></p>
<p>The results mirror findings on fungal communities in apples.</p>
<p>&#8220;Our results agree remarkably with a <a href="https://www.ncbi.nlm.nih.gov/pmc/articles/PMC5051542/pdf/hortres201647.pdf" target="_blank" rel="noopener">recent study</a> on the apple fruit-associated fungal community, which revealed specificity of fungal varieties to different tissues and management practices,&#8221; comments Birgit Wasserman, Berg protégé and lead author of the study.</p>
<p>Together the studies show that across both bacteria and fungi, the apple microbiome is more diverse in organically grown fruits. Since another study has shown that the apple fungal community is also variety-specific, the bacterial analyses too should be repeated in other cultivars.</p>
<p>&#8220;The microbiome and antioxidant profiles of fresh produce may one day become standard nutritional information, displayed alongside macronutrients, vitamins and minerals to guide consumers,&#8221; suggests Wasserman. &#8220;Here, a key step will be to confirm to what extent diversity in the food microbiome translates to gut microbial diversity and improved health outcomes.&#8221;</p>

		<title>Electrolytes help lower blood pressure</title>

			<content:encoded><![CDATA[<p><span style="color: #808080;"><em>Natural Health News —</em></span> Increasing levels of electrolytes such as potassium and magnesium, while lowering sodium intake, could be as effective as drugs for lowering blood pressure.</p>
<p>The conclusion comes from a new analysis which looked at the intake of electrolytes in relation to hypertension.</p>
<p>Electrolytes are minerals that have an electric charge. Dissolved in water or in blood, urine, tissues and other body fluids, they help increase electrical conductivity which helps ensure that nerves, muscles, the heart and the brain work the way they should. Key electrolytes include sodium, potassium, chloride, calcium, magnesium and phosphate.</p>
<p>Scientists from the Medical University Vienna reviewed of 32 peer-reviewed meta-analyses published within the last 10 years that studied the effect or association between electrolytes and blood pressure in humans. In a paper published earlier this month in the journal <em><a href="https://www.mdpi.com/2072-6643/11/6/1362">Nutrients​​​</a></em>, they noted that the potassium&#8217;s ability to lower systolic blood pressure &#8220;was approximately in the order of 8 to 9 mmHg, which roughly equals a monotherapy with an antihypertensive drug.”​</p>
<p>Higher magnesium intake was also associated with beneficial effects on blood pressure, although the results were “moderate.”​</p>
<p>The analysis also found that existing literature about the role of calcium in blood pressure suggests that its benefits are restricted to the prevention of hypertension during pregnancy.</p>
<p>This, they argued, is supported by the fact that low dietary calcium intake has been recognised by most health authorities as a risk factor for the development of hypertension especially for women with a history of gestational hypertension. The World Health Organization, for example, <a href="https://apps.who.int/iris/bitstream/handle/10665/85120/9789241505376_eng.pdf;jsessionid=C3E86D38E930E53861098261C63B1F07?sequence=1">recommends</a>​​ daily calcium supplementation of 1.5–2.0 g oral elemental calcium for pregnant women with low dietary calcium intake to reduce the risk of pre-eclampsia and related complications</p>
<p><strong>Widely available</strong></p>
<p>The results are encouraging for anyone suffering from uncomplicated high blood pressure. Electrolytes are widely available in mineral-rich whole foods such as leafy greens, cruciferous veggies like broccoli or cabbage, starchy vegetables like sweet potatoes or squash, bananas, and avocados as well as high water foods such as milk and yoghurt,<strong> c</strong>oconut water, watermelon, celery and citrus fruits. They can also be taken as supplements and are a generally an inexpensive option for health maintenance.</p>
<p>More research is needed to understand the role of all electrolytes in mediating blood pressure, however. For instance the researchers noted that they could not find any good quality meta-analyses summarizing the effects of key elements such as chloride, phosphorus and sulphur, on blood pressure or hypertension risk.</p>
<p>“In general, few studies are available, which assessed the effect of these electrolytes on blood pressure,”​ they reported. “There are indications from observational studies that there might be some effects, however robust evidence is missing.”​</p>
<p>With better information a supplemental approach to uncomplicated high blood pressure could become a treatment option or some.</p>

		<title>Childhood asthma and inflammation &#8211; the role of dietary fatty acids</title>

			<content:encoded><![CDATA[<p class="lead"><em><span style="color: #808080;">Natural Health News — </span></em>Dietary intake of two fatty acids, omega-3 and omega-6, may have opposite effects on the severity of asthma in children and may also play opposite roles in modifying their response to indoor air pollution.</p>
<p>Omega-3 fatty acids, which are found in fish, soybeans and certain nuts and seeds, are considered healthy in part because they can encourage resolution of inflammation in the body. Omega-6 fatty acids, primarily found in vegetable oils, have mixed effects on health but generally promote inflammation.</p>
<p>In a new study, published in the <a href="https://www.atsjournals.org/doi/10.1164/rccm.201808-1474OC" target="_blank" rel="noopener"><em><span style="color: blue;">American Journal of Respiratory and Critical Care Medicine</span></em></a>, researchers from Johns Hopkins University looked at 135 children, ages 5-12 (average age: 9.5), with asthma.</p>
<p>Roughly a third of the children had mild asthma, a third moderate and a third severe asthma. Ninety-six percent of the children were African American, and 47% were girls.</p>
<p>The children&#8217;s diet, daily asthma symptoms and asthma medication use were assessed for one week at enrolment and again for one week at three and six months.</p>
<p>During the same time periods, the investigators measured two types of home indoor particulate pollution, PM 2.5 and PM 10, which are known asthma triggers and lead to increased symptoms in children with asthma. Invisible to the naked eye, PM 2.5 penetrates deeply into the lungs, reaching the tiny air sacs, or alveoli. PM 10 includes particles larger than PM 2.5, but still with a diameter of one-sixth the width of a human hair or less. When inhaled, these larger particles are deposited along the airways.</p>
<p><strong>Monitoring symptoms</strong></p>
<p>Analysis showed that children with higher levels of omega-3 in their diets had less severe asthma and fewer symptoms in response to higher levels of indoor particulate air pollution. Conversely, children with higher levels of omega-6 in their diets had more severe asthma and more symptoms in response to higher levels of indoor particulate matter pollution.</p>
<p>&#8220;There is mounting evidence that diet, particularly omega-3 and omega-6 fatty acids, may play a role in lung health,&#8221; said Emily P. Brigham, MD, MHS, lead study author and assistant professor of medicine at Johns Hopkins University.</p>
<p>&#8220;Many children in the U.S., including those in Baltimore City [Maryland], where we conducted our research, consume a diet that deviates sharply from national guidelines. Typically, this means they are eating low amounts of omega-3, and higher amounts of omega-6,&#8221; said Dr Brigham, adding that paediatric asthma rates in the city are more than twice the national average.</p>
<p>&#8220;Because children with asthma are already prone to inflammation and respiratory symptoms, we wanted to see if these fatty acids could be further contributing to their disease severity and symptoms in response to indoor air pollution, which is often elevated in inner-city homes.&#8221;</p>
<p>The study also found that higher levels of omega-6 in the children&#8217;s diet correlated with higher percentages of neutrophils (a type of white blood cell linked with inflammation) in response to particulate pollution.</p>
<p><strong>Don&#8217;t underestimate diet&#8217;s impact</strong></p>
<p>The study did have some limitations. The children&#8217;s intake of the fatty acids was self-reported by the children, with help from parents, using a dietary questionnaire specifically designed for residents of Baltimore City. Because the study was observational rather than a randomized, controlled trial, the researchers could not prove cause and effect or rule out other factors that may have contributed to relationships noted with asthma health.</p>
<p>Nevertheless, the researchers believe their study highlights the potential importance of diet to a population that experiences high rates of asthma.</p>
<p>&#8220;If there is a causal relationship between diet and asthma, a healthier diet may protect children with asthma, particularly minority children living in the inner city, from some of the harmful effects of air pollution,&#8221; Dr Brigham said. &#8220;Among vulnerable populations, we may find that improving diet and air pollution together has the greatest impact on asthma health.&#8221;</p>

		<title>Losing weight could ease symptoms of depression</title>

			<content:encoded><![CDATA[<p class="lead"><span style="color: #808080;"><em>Natural Health News —</em></span> Weight loss, nutrient boosting and fat reduction diets can all reduce the symptoms of depression, according to new data.</p>
<p>The study, which looked at data from almost 46,000 people, provides convincing evidence that dietary improvement significantly reduces symptoms of depression, even in people without diagnosed depressive disorders.</p>
<p>According to lead researcher, Dr Joseph Firth, an Honorary Research fellow at The University of Manchester and Research Fellow at NICM Health Research Institute at Western Sydney University, existing research has been unable to definitively establish if dietary improvement could benefit mental health.</p>
<p>But this new analysis published in <a href="https://insights.ovid.com/crossref?an=00006842-900000000-98656" target="_blank" rel="noopener"><em><span style="color: blue; text-decoration: none; text-underline: none;">Psychosomatic Medicine</span></em></a>, brought together existing data from large clinical trials of diets for mental health conditions to help provide better insight</p>
<p>&#8220;The overall evidence for the effects of diet on mood and mental well-being had up to now yet to be assessed. But our recent meta-analysis has done just that; showing that adopting a healthier diet can boost peoples&#8217; mood. However, it has no clear effects on anxiety.&#8221;</p>
<p><strong>Linking food to mood</strong></p>
<p>The study combined data from 16 randomised controlled trials that examined the effects of dietary interventions on symptoms of depression and anxiety. The majority of these examined people with non-clinical depression.</p>
<p>The study found that all types of dietary improvement appeared to have equal effects on mental health, with weight-loss, fat reduction or nutrient-improving diets all having similar benefits for depressive symptoms.</p>
<p>&#8220;This is actually good news&#8221; said Dr Firth; &#8220;The similar effects from any type of dietary improvement suggests that highly-specific or specialised diets are unnecessary for the average individual.</p>
<p>&#8220;Instead, just making simple changes is equally beneficial for mental health. In particular, eating more nutrient-dense meals which are high in fibre and vegetables, while cutting back on fast-foods and refined sugars appears to be sufficient for avoiding the potentially negative psychological effects of a &#8216;junk food&#8217; diet.</p>
<p><strong>Support for a lifestyle approach</strong></p>
<p>Dr Brendon Stubbs, co-author of the study and Clinical Lecturer at the NIHR Maudsley Biomedical Research Centre and King&#8217;s College London, added: &#8220;Our data add to the growing evidence to support lifestyle interventions as an important approach to tackle low mood and depression.</p>
<p>&#8220;Specifically, our results within this study found that when dietary interventions were combined with exercise, a greater improvement in depressive symptoms was experienced by people. Taken together, our data really highlight the central role of eating a healthier diet and taking regular exercise to act as a viable treatment to help people with low mood.&#8221;</p>
<p>Interestingly in the studies examined, women derived the greatest benefit from dietary interventions for symptoms of both depression and anxiety.</p>
<p>The analysis was not able to pinpoint why but according to Dr Firth added: &#8220;It could be through reducing obesity, inflammation, or fatigue &#8211; all of which are linked to diet and impact upon mental health.&#8221;</p>

		<title>Artificial sweeteners &#8211; no clear evidence of benefit</title>

			<content:encoded><![CDATA[<p id="first" class="lead"><span style="color: #808080;"><em>Natural Health News —</em></span> There is no compelling evidence to indicate important health benefits of non-sugar sweeteners, and potential harms cannot be ruled out, suggests a new review.</p>
<div id="text">
<p>Growing concerns about health and quality of life have encouraged many people to adopt healthier lifestyles and avoid foods rich in sugars, salt, or fat. Foods and drinks containing non-sugar sweeteners rather than regular (&#8220;free&#8221;) sugars have therefore become increasingly popular.</p>
<p>Although several non-sugar sweeteners are approved for use, less is known about their potential benefits and harms within acceptable daily intakes beacuse the evidence is often limited and conflicting.</p>
<p>To better understand these potential benefits and harms, a team of European researchers analysed 56 studies comparing no intake or lower intake of non-sugar sweeteners with higher intake in healthy adults and children.</p>
<p>The analysis of published studies which appeared in the<a href="https://www.bmj.com/content/364/bmj.k4718" target="_blank" rel="noopener"><em> British Medical Journal</em></a> looked at measures included weight, blood sugar (glycaemic) control, oral health, cancer, cardiovascular disease, kidney disease, mood and behaviour. Studies were assessed for bias and certainty of evidence.</p>
<p><strong>No real benefits</strong></p>
<p>Overall, the results show that, for most outcomes, there seemed to be no statistically or clinically relevant differences between those exposed to non-sugar sweeteners and those not exposed, or between different doses of non-sugar sweeteners.</p>
<p>For example, in adults, findings from a few small studies suggested small improvements in body mass index and fasting blood glucose levels with non-sugar sweeteners, but the certainty of this evidence was low.</p>
<p>Lower intakes of non-sugar sweeteners were associated with slightly less weight gain (-0.09 kg) than higher intakes, but again the certainty of this evidence was low.</p>
<p>In children, a smaller increase in body mass index score was seen with non-sugar sweeteners compared with sugar, but intake of non-sugar sweeteners made no differences to body weight.</p>
<p>In addition, no good evidence of any effect of non-sugar sweeteners was found for overweight or obese adults or children actively trying to lose weight.</p>
<p>The researchers point out that this is the most comprehensive review on this topic to date, and will inform a World Health Organization guideline for health experts and policy makers.</p>
<p><strong>More and better quality evidence needed?</strong></p>
<p>However, they stress that the quality of evidence in many of the studies was low, so confidence in the results is limited. And they say longer term studies are needed to clarify whether non-sugar sweeteners are a safe and effective alternative to sugar.</p>
<p>In an <a href="https://www.bmj.com/content/364/bmj.k5005" target="_blank" rel="noopener">editorial</a> in the same edition, Vasanti Malik at Harvard TH Chan School of Public Health agrees that more studies are needed to understand the potential health effects of non-sugar sweeteners and to guide policy development.</p>
<p>&#8220;Policies and recommendations will need updating regularly, as more evidence emerges to ensure that the best available data is used to inform the important public health debate on sugar and its alternatives,&#8221; she concludes.</p>

		<title>Weight control and heart benefits linked to daily nut consumption</title>

			<content:encoded><![CDATA[<p id="first" class="lead"><span style="color: #808080;"><em>Natural Health News —</em></span> A daily serving of nuts may prevent weight gain and provide other cardiovascular benefits, according to two separate preliminary studies commissioned by the American Heart Association.</p>
<div id="text">
<p>One study looked at the influence of eating nuts and peanuts on long-term body weight in American men and women. The other examined whether eating Brazil nuts could increases a sense of fullness and improve glucose and insulin responses.</p>
<p>In the nuts and peanuts study, nut consumption was assessed through a food-frequency questionnaire submitted to participants every four years in three different established study groups of 25,394 men in the Health Professionals Follow-up Study, 53,541 women in the Nurse&#8217;s Health Study and 47,255 women in the Nurse&#8217;s Health Study II in follow-up research.</p>
<p>Specifically the findings revealed that:</p>
<ul>
<li>Eating a daily serving of any type of nut or peanuts was associated with less risk of weight gain or becoming obese over the four-year intervals.</li>
<li>Substituting one serving a day of any type of nuts in place of one serving of red meat, processed meat, French fries, desserts or potato chips was associated with less weight gain over the four-year intervals.</li>
</ul>
<p><strong>A healthy snack</strong></p>
<p>A serving of nuts is defined as one ounce of whole nuts or two tablespoons of nut butter. &#8220;People often see nuts as food items high in fat and calories, so they hesitate to consider them as healthy snacks, but they are in fact associated with less weight gain and wellness,&#8221; said Xiaoran Liu, PhD, first author of the study and a research associate in the nutrition department of Harvard School of Public Health in Boston, Massachusetts.</p>
<p>&#8220;Once people reach adulthood, they start to gradually gain about one pound a year of weight, which seems small. But if you consider gaining one pound over 20 years, it accumulates to a lot of weight gain,&#8221; she said. &#8220;Adding one ounce of nuts to your diet in place of less healthy foods &#8211; such as red or processed meat, French fries or sugary snacks &#8211; may help prevent that slow, gradual weight gain after you enter adulthood and reduce the risk of obesity-related cardiovascular diseases.&#8221;</p>
<p>Participants were mainly white and health professionals, but researchers believe even so the findings can be applied to a general population.</p>
<p><strong>Blood sugar benefits<br />
</strong></p>
<p>In the Brazil nut study, conducted at San Diego State University in 2017 through a grant from the American Heart Association, 22 healthy adults (20 women and two men) age 20 or older with a mean body mass index of 22.3, consumed either 36 grams of pretzels or 20 grams of Brazil nuts (about five nuts) in addition to their usual diet. The Brazil nuts and pretzels had approximately the same amount of calories and sodium. Participants ate either the nuts or the pretzels in two trials with a washout period of at least 48 hours to prevent carryover effects.</p>
<p>The study found:</p>
<ul>
<li>Both Brazil nuts and pretzels significantly increased a sense of fullness and reduced feelings of hunger, with the greatest sense of fullness experienced by the group eating Brazil nuts compared to those eating pretzels.</li>
<li>Pretzel consumption caused a significant increase in blood glucose and insulin at 40-minutes after they were eaten, compared to the start of the trial, whereas eating Brazil nuts did not significantly increase blood glucose or insulin.</li>
</ul>
<p>&#8220;While both Brazil nuts and pretzels increased a sense of fullness after they were eaten, eating Brazil nuts stabilised postprandial (after eating) blood glucose and insulin levels, which may be beneficial in preventing diabetes and weight gain,&#8221; said Mee Young Hong, PhD, RD, senior author of the study and professor in the School of Exercise &amp; Nutritional Sciences at San Diego State University in San Diego, California.</p>
<p>Brazil nuts are one of the highest known food sources of selenium, a mineral which the researchers note in previous studies may be associated with improvements in insulin and glucose responses. Insulin is produced in the pancreas and is a catalyst for processing glucose into energy. Some people are insulin resistant or don&#8217;t produce enough insulin, which means glucose can reach unhealthy levels and result in diabetes, a major risk factor for heart attacks and strokes.</p>
<p>In the Brazil nut study, only 9% of the participants were men, so the findings should not be generalised to a male population according to Hong.</p>
<p>The two studies were presented ahead of publication at the recent <a href="https://newsroom.heart.org/news/nuts-for-nuts?preview=2c6d" target="_blank" rel="noopener">American Heart Association&#8217;s Scientific Sessions 2018</a> in Chicago.</p>

		<title>Nutrient-dense diet has extra benefits for women&#8217;s brains</title>

<p id="first" class="lead"><span style="color: #808080;"><em>Natural Health News —</em></span> Women may need a more nutrient-rich diet to support a positive emotional well-being, according to new research.</p>
<p>According to a team of US scientists, mounting evidence suggests that anatomical and functional differences in men&#8217;s and women&#8217;s brains influence susceptibility to mental health problems. However, little is known about the role of dietary patterns in gender-specific psychological wellbeing.</p>
<p>To find out more, a team of researchers led by Lina Begdache, assistant professor of health and wellness studies at Binghamton University, State University at New York, conducted an anonymous survey of 563 participants (48% men and 52% women) through social media to investigate this issue.</p>
<p>Writing in the journal <a href="https://www.tandfonline.com/doi/full/10.1080/1028415X.2018.1500198" target="_blank" rel="noopener"><em>Nutritional Neuroscience</em></a>​, Begdache and her team found that men are more likely to experience mental well-being until nutritional deficiencies arise. Women, however, are less likely to experience mental well-being until a balanced diet and a healthy lifestyle are followed.</p>
<p><strong>Gender differences go deep</strong></p>
<p>“Evidence suggests that our ancestors&#8217; diet, which was a high-energy-nutrient-dense diet, contributed significantly to brain volumes and cognitive evolution of mankind,”​ said Dr Begdache.</p>
<p>&#8220;Males and females had different physical and emotional responsibilities that may have necessitated different energy requirements and food preference.&#8221; ​</p>
<p>Dr Begdache said that, as a result, gender-based differences in food and energy intake may explain the differences in brain volumes and connectivity between females and males.</p>
<div id="text">
<p>According to Begdache, these results may also explain reports from previous studies that show that women are at a greater risk for mental distress when compared to men, and emphasize the role of a nutrient-dense diet in mental wellbeing.</p>
<p><strong>Mediterranean diet is supportive</strong></p>
<p>&#8220;The biggest takeaway is that women may need a larger spectrum of nutrients to support mood, compared to men,&#8221; said Begdache. &#8220;These findings may explain the reason why women are twice more likely to be diagnosed with anxiety and depression and suffer from longer episodes, compared to men. Today&#8217;s diet is high in energy but poor in key nutrients that support brain anatomy and functionality.&#8221;</p>
</div>
<p>The research suggests that polyphenols, omega-3 oils and folate are particularly beneficial for women. These nutrients are found in abundance, they note, in the Mediterranean diet.</p>
<p>“Beans (high in polyphenols) and fish (rich in omega-3 fats) intakes, specifically, associated with increased cortical thickness.&#8221; said Begdache who notes that  polyphenols have an active role to play in normal brain signalling and neurological health. ​</p>

		<title>UK analysis: young adults, prospective parents missing key nutrients</title>

			<content:encoded><![CDATA[<p><span style="color: #808080;"><em>Natural Health News</em> —</span> Women and men in their childbearing years, as well as young people in general, are not getting the key micronutrients they need from food.</p>
<p>A secondary analysis of the UK National Diet and Nutrition Survey, published in <em><a href="https://www.frontiersin.org/articles/10.3389/fnut.2018.00055/full">Frontiers in Nutrition</a></em>, highlights a tendency to report micronutrients intakes collectively for adults, with broad age ranges being used. This means that certain sub-population groups such as younger adults are often overlooked.</p>
<p>The current analysis, which looked at these subpopulations, noted that improvements in dietary quality are needed in young adulthood and mid-life. To achieve this, they note, supplementation strategies could help young adults be where they should be at these ages &#8211; in their “nutritional prime.”</p>
<p>The analysis found sizeable deficiencies in several important nutrients. For magnesium in both men and women, 19% of young people in their twenties having intakes below the Lowest Recommended Nutrient Intake (LRNI). There were also considerable gender gaps in dietary selenium intakes, with 50% females and 26% of males having total intakes beneath the LRNI.</p>
<p>Furthermore, a quarter of women had both iron and potassium intakes below the LRNI, while among UK males, vitamin A and zinc shortfalls were apparent.</p>

<p>The researchers say that an adequate micronutrient profile for women is not only important for fertility but also to prepare the body for the extensive physiological demands should pregnancy occur. Selenium, for example, has been highlighted as a crucial nutrient for women seeking to become pregnant.</p>
<p>By increasing their risk of preeclampsia, mothers with low selenium levels may also be at increased risk for heart disease, stroke and high blood pressure later in life. The summary calls for higher levels of supplementation of high selenium yeast to combat heart health threats.</p>
<p><strong>Male fertility at risk too</strong></p>
<p>Zinc, of course, is a known antioxidant with research showing that fertile males tend to have higher seminal zinc levels than their infertile men. Zinc also helps to support immunity and avert age-related diseases.</p>
<p>Zinc shortfalls are somewhat surprising to see, the researchers add, especially among males, given that meat and meat products are one of the main providers of zinc. It is possible that younger men in their twenties are eating less meat which could have contributed to lower zinc intakes in this age group, the researchers note. This is an important finding and worthy of consideration in the context of public health given current trends toward plant-based diets, they explain.</p>
<p>In terms of the low vitamin A intake found in males, the researchers found that young men&#8217;s mean intakes of fruit and vegetables were slightly lower at 3.9 portions daily compared with 4.1 portions daily among women aged 19 to 64 years. It has also been found that fruit and vegetable variety tends to be lower in men, especially in instances where education and social class is lower.</p>
<p><strong>Why are levels so low?</strong><br />
Adequate nutrition at this stage of life can also help to future-proof health against debilitating and chronic diseases that can occur in later life.</p>
<p>The researchers suggested that when it comes to women’s nutritional shortfalls, societal pressures around body image could be a factor. They cite a recent survey of 1,035 social media tweets typically used by young adults that found that 67% related to body image, eating disorders, fitness, food or dieting. This, in turn, could have wider ramifications impacting on dietary habits and micronutrient profiles of young women.</p>
<p>Emerging food trends and the avoidance of food groups could also be impacting on micronutrient intakes. For example, the consumption of eggs, milk, and dairy correlates strongly against female nutritional iodine status while veganism has also been found to impact on vitamin D, calcium and vitamin B12, iodine and selenium intakes. They further add that UK females having diets lower in red meat (less than 40 g daily) have reduced micronutrient intakes, especially zinc and vitamin D.</p>
<p>“It is imperative to continue raising awareness about the importance of healthy and balanced diets and adequate micronutrient intakes. The implications of ‘cutting back or cutting out’ certain food groups also need to be communicated, especially to younger generations who are strongly influenced by social media which is not subject to peer review or monitoring systems,” says author Dr. Emma Derbyshire, Public Health Nutritionist and an advisor to the Health &amp; Food Supplements Information Service (HSIS).</p>
<p><strong>A daily insurance policy</strong><br />
The current research found that females and young adults are at particular risk of micronutrient shortfalls. In an environment, where the public are being encouraged to reduce their energy intakes, it is important to ensure that younger people get the nutrient they need sand that multivitamin and mineral supplements could help.</p>
<p>Supplement, of course, are no substitute for a healthy diet, but as the nutrient content of our food declines and food fads become more prevalent, they may be an important insurance policy for health.
